we have the following problem with machinekit (latest version from 
repositories, debian stretch):

If we launch machinekit with an original (linuxcn-style) HAL-file:

loadrt hostmot2
loadrt hm2_pci config=" num_encoders=1 num_stepgens=4 
sserial_port_0=00xxxxxx " 

we can read out a 7i76-daughterboard digital in pin via halmeter.

On the other hand, if we use a python-HAL:

rt.loadrt('hostmot2')
rt.loadrt('hm2_pci', config=' num_encoders=1 num_stepgens=4 
sserial_port_0=00xxxxxx')

halmeter shows the pins, but they show only false, regardless of the actual 
input value.

Do you have any ideas?
